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ences vs. ASI Career Institute
Both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ences and ASI Career Institute are Private, Less than 2 years schools located in New Jersey. The following statements compare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ences and ASI Career Institute with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ences's tuition ($20,465) is more expensive than ASI Career Institute ($11,500).
- ASI Career Institute's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ences (12 to 1).
-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ences (134 students) is larger than ASI Career Institute (33 students) with more enrolled students.
-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ences ($6,108) has higher amount of financial aid than ASI Career Institute ($4,411).
- ASI Career Institute's graduation rate (94%) is higher than Hohokus School of Trade and Technical Sciences (80%).
